Historical Roots and Philosophical Underpinnings

The concept of the Law of Attraction is not a modern invention but has deep roots in various spiritual, philosophical, and esoteric traditions throughout history. Ancient civilizations, from Egyptian mystics to Vedic sages, recognized the profound connection between thought, intention, and reality. Texts like the Hermetic principles, particularly "The Kybalion," articulate the principle of Mentalism, stating that "The All is Mind; the Universe is Mental," suggesting that the universe itself is a mental creation and that our thoughts play a fundamental role in shaping it.

During the 19th century, the New Thought movement in the Western world brought these ideas into a more structured framework. Figures like Phineas Quimby, Ralph Waldo Emerson, and later, authors such as Wallace D. Wattles and Napoleon Hill, explored and popularized the idea that individuals could harness mental power to achieve success, health, and happiness. Wattles' "The Science of Getting Rich" (1910) is often cited as a foundational text, detailing how specific thought patterns and mental attitudes can lead to material abundance.

These historical perspectives highlight a consistent theme: the human mind is not merely a passive observer of reality but an active participant in its creation. This understanding forms the bedrock of the contemporary Law of Attraction, emphasizing personal responsibility and empowerment in shaping one's life experiences. The Core Principles of the Law of Attraction

At its heart, the Law of Attraction operates on several interconnected principles. Understanding these is crucial for effective application. The primary tenets revolve around vibration, thought, and emotion, which together create a powerful energetic signature that the universe responds to.

  • The Principle of Vibration: Everything in the universe, including our thoughts and emotions, is energy and vibrates at a specific frequency. The Law of Attraction posits that similar vibrations attract each other. Therefore, to attract what you desire, you must align your vibrational frequency with that of your desire.
  • The Power of Thought: Thoughts are powerful forms of energy. Positive thoughts tend to attract positive outcomes, while negative thoughts attract negative ones. This principle emphasizes the importance of conscious thought management and cultivating a positive mindset.
  • The Role of Emotion: Emotions are indicators of our vibrational frequency. Feeling good means you are in alignment with higher, more positive vibrations, making you a magnet for desirable experiences. Conversely, negative emotions signal a lower vibration, attracting less desirable outcomes.
  • The Law of Deliberate Creation: This principle asserts that you have the ability to intentionally choose your thoughts and emotions to create your desired reality. It moves beyond passive attraction to active, conscious participation in shaping your life.

These principles suggest that our internal state—our thoughts, feelings, and beliefs—is a direct determinant of our external reality. By mastering these internal states, individuals can gain significant control over their life experiences. Practical Application: How to Consciously Create Your Reality

Applying the Law of Attraction effectively requires a systematic approach, moving beyond mere intellectual understanding to consistent practice. It involves several key steps that, when followed diligently, can significantly enhance your ability to manifest your desires. These steps are designed to align your thoughts, emotions, and actions with your intentions.

  • Clarify Your Desires: The first and most crucial step is to be absolutely clear about what you want. Vague desires yield vague results. Define your goals with precision, envisioning them in as much detail as possible. Write them down, making them tangible and specific.
  • Cultivate a Positive Mindset: Actively work on shifting your thoughts towards positivity. This doesn't mean ignoring challenges but rather focusing on solutions and opportunities. Practice mindfulness to become aware of your thought patterns and gently redirect negative ones.
  • Feel the Emotion of Having It Now: This is perhaps the most powerful aspect. Generate the feelings you would experience if your desire were already a reality. Joy, gratitude, excitement, and peace are high-vibrational emotions that accelerate manifestation.
  • Release Resistance: Often, subconscious beliefs or fears can create resistance, blocking your desires. Identify and address these limiting beliefs. Techniques like meditation, journaling, and self-reflection can help release these energetic blocks.
  • Take Inspired Action: While the Law of Attraction emphasizes mental and emotional work, it is not passive. Pay attention to intuitive nudges or opportunities that arise and take aligned action. These actions are often effortless and feel right.

Consistent practice of these steps helps to create a powerful magnetic field around your desires, drawing them closer to you. It's a continuous cycle of intention, feeling, belief, and action. Visualization and Affirmations: Tools for Manifestation

Two of the most widely recognized and effective techniques for applying the Law of Attraction are visualization and affirmations. These practices directly engage the subconscious mind, helping to reprogram beliefs and align vibrational frequencies with desired outcomes.

  • Visualization: This involves creating vivid mental images of your desired reality. The key is to engage all your senses in this mental rehearsal. Imagine what you would see, hear, smell, taste, and touch when your desire is fulfilled. Crucially, feel the emotions associated with this future reality as if it were happening now. Regular visualization sessions, especially upon waking and before sleep, can deeply impress these images upon your subconscious.
  • Affirmations: Affirmations are positive statements declared in the present tense, asserting your desired reality. They are designed to counteract limiting beliefs and reinforce positive ones. Examples include "I am abundant and prosperous," "I am healthy and vibrant," or "I attract loving relationships." Repetition, conviction, and emotional resonance are vital for affirmations to be effective.

Both visualization and affirmations work by creating new neural pathways in the brain, effectively training your mind to believe in and expect your desires. This internal shift then influences your external reality. Consistency is paramount for these tools to yield significant results. Common Misconceptions and Ethical Considerations

Despite its growing popularity, the Law of Attraction is often misunderstood, leading to frustration or misapplication. Addressing these common misconceptions is vital for a balanced and ethical practice.

  • It's Not Just About Thinking Positively: A common misconception is that simply thinking positive thoughts is enough. While positive thinking is crucial, it must be accompanied by genuine positive emotion and, often, inspired action. Superficial positivity without emotional alignment is unlikely to yield results.
  • It's Not a "Get Rich Quick" Scheme: The Law of Attraction is not a magical shortcut to instant wealth or success without effort. It requires consistent focus, belief, and often, diligent work in alignment with your desires. It's about attracting opportunities and resources, not receiving something for nothing.
  • It Doesn't Blame Victims: A sensitive point of contention is the idea that individuals attract negative experiences, implying victim-blaming. Proponents clarify that while our thoughts and emotions contribute to our reality, it does not mean people consciously choose or deserve suffering. Instead, it offers a framework for empowerment to change one's circumstances.
  • Ethical Considerations: The Law of Attraction emphasizes personal responsibility. It encourages individuals to focus on their own growth and desires without infringing on the free will or well-being of others. Ethical application means manifesting for the highest good of all involved, avoiding manipulative or selfish intentions.

A mature understanding of the Law of Attraction acknowledges its power while recognizing its limitations and the importance of ethical conduct. It's a tool for personal empowerment, not a means to control others or bypass personal growth. Scientific Perspectives and Modern Interpretations

While the Law of Attraction is primarily a spiritual or philosophical concept, modern science, particularly in fields like quantum physics, neuroscience, and psychology, offers intriguing parallels and potential explanations for its observed effects. Although direct scientific proof of the Law of Attraction as a universal law is lacking, the mechanisms behind its effectiveness can be partially understood through established scientific principles.

  • Quantum Physics and Energy: Some interpretations draw loose analogies to quantum physics, where observation can influence reality at a subatomic level. While this is a highly debated and often misapplied analogy, the idea that everything is energy and vibrates at different frequencies resonates with the Law of Attraction's core principle of vibration.
  • Neuroscience and Brain Plasticity: Neuroscience offers more concrete explanations. The brain's plasticity allows it to adapt and reorganize itself based on experiences and thoughts. Consistent visualization and positive affirmations can literally rewire neural pathways, making the brain more attuned to opportunities that align with desired outcomes. The Reticular Activating System (RAS) in the brain, for instance, filters information and focuses attention on what we deem important, making us more likely to notice things related to our intentions.
  • Psychology and Self-Fulfilling Prophecies: From a psychological standpoint, the Law of Attraction aligns with concepts like the self-fulfilling prophecy and cognitive biases. When individuals believe they will succeed, they are more likely to take actions that lead to success. Positive expectations can influence behavior, motivation, and resilience, ultimately increasing the likelihood of achieving goals.
  • Placebo Effect: The powerful influence of belief on physical and mental states, as seen in the placebo effect, also provides a psychological framework. Believing in a positive outcome can trigger real physiological and psychological changes that contribute to that outcome.

These scientific insights do not necessarily "prove" the Law of Attraction in a spiritual sense, but they do offer robust explanations for why focused intention, positive belief, and emotional alignment can lead to tangible results in one's life.
